Wandering Minstrel. Wandering Minstrel is a Hyur found in Mor Dhona. He provides unlocks for most high-end duties (most extreme trials, some savage raids, and all ultimate raids) by asking the player character to recount their original combat encounters. If you have completed the "Messenger of the Winds" quest, speak to Kipih Jakkya to make use of the Seasonal Event Replay feature. Once you use the feature, the following quests will be treated as incomplete, allowing you to play them again. "The Man in Black" "In the Dark of Night" "Messenger of the Winds"

To start the FFXV event in FFXIV, you must make your way to Ul’dah, Steps of Nald. The exact coordinates are X:8.5, Y:9.7. At this location, you will meet the FFXIV version of Rita Skeeter, NPC Kipih Jakkya. Nhagi'a Jakkya is the brother of Kipih Jakkya, who has been in the game since 1.x where she was played by a GM and would go around interviewing players about the oncoming calamity.
